Output 2fbb85a356c5e0039a3a78c97998aa3dd21838c2d85cdd18d4d6763075b2830f:28

value
26986997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e19b79448f6ea71dc402dcfacf37effddb78890 OP_EQUAL
address
MLrWzXTfpxsiZpP6ucWi88BEGa8rQj6hCy
transaction
2fbb85a356c5e0039a3a78c97998aa3dd21838c2d85cdd18d4d6763075b2830f
spent
true